
Croatian MPs to pay official visit to Chișinău
A delegation of deputies from the European Affairs Committee of the Parliament of the Republic of Croatia will pay an official visit to the Republic of Moldova on June 18-19.
According to the parliament's communication and public relations department, the visit aims to strengthen bilateral cooperation and support the European path of the Republic of Moldova.
During the visit, Croatian MPs will meet with Speaker Igor Grosu, members of the Foreign Policy and European Integration Committee, as well as Moldova-Croatia Parliamentary Friendship Group.
In this context, on 18 June, at 11:00 AM, Chair of the Foreign Policy and European Integration Committee Ina Coșeru and her counterpart from the Croatian Parliament, Jelena Miloš, will hold a conference.
The Croatian delegation will also have meetings with Deputy Prime Minister for European Integration Cristina Gherasimov, Deputy Prime Minister for Reintegration Oleg Serebrian and Minister of Energy Dorin Junghietu. The visit's agenda also includes discussions with representatives of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and civil society.
The discussions will focus on the cooperation between our country and the Republic of Croatia, as well as the European path of the Republic of Moldova.
